The Tajemství collection transforms jewelry into deeply personal messages. These earrings carry the inscription “I am happy”, offering a quiet yet powerful affirmation of joy, gratitude, and presence.
Crafted from stainless steel, the earrings are minimalist, lightweight, and versatile for everyday wear. Their clean form and subtle message make them a thoughtful gift or personal talisman. Please note: the image in gold is for illustrative purposes only – the earrings are made of uncoated stainless steel.

Klára Šípková
Klára Šípková is a prominent Czech jewelry designer known for merging contemporary design with expert craftsmanship. Her minimalist yet expressive pieces often explore symbolic meaning, making her work both visually appealing and emotionally resonant. She has been nominated several times for Czech Grand Design’s Jewelry Designer of the Year.

Klára Šípková is a leading figure in contemporary Czech jewellery design. Her work is defined by a willingness to experiment—discovering unconventional materials, rethinking traditional craft methods and exploring the boundaries between artistic intention and wearable design. Each collection reflects her signature minimalism, rooted in clean forms, refined lines and a strong sense of functionality.
Šípková seeks a balance between aesthetic clarity and conceptual depth. Her pieces are created for women who embrace individuality and prefer jewellery with a distinctive character. Her artistic journey includes studies at the Academy of Arts, Architecture & Design in Prague (UMPRUM), a formative internship at École Supérieure d’Arts Graphiques et d’Architecture Intérieure (ESAG) in Paris, and years of work in her own studio.
As a co-founder of UNOSTO, she actively supports a new generation of Czech jewellery artists and contributes to shaping the discourse around contemporary jewellery. Since 2011, she has participated in exhibitions, workshops and international collaborations.
She has received numerous nominations for the Czech Grand Design Jewellery Designer of the Year award, and her early projects won recognition in the National Student Design Award and the Jewellery of the Year competition. Today, Šípková is recognised for pushing the field forward through experimentation, elegant minimalism and highly skilled craftsmanship.
